“Congratulations! You’re hired.”
After the job search, interviews, and all that waiting, those words can feel like a huge relief. A new job means a fresh start and, of course, a regular salary to look forward to.
But joining a new company doesn’t mean everything changes overnight. Your financial situation is still what it was before, and an expense can come up before you’ve even settled into the new role. In that situation, finding a loan for newly joined employees may seem like the next thing to explore.
But can you actually get a personal loan when you’ve just started a new job?
Being new at a company does not automatically mean you have to wait years before applying for an emergency personal loan.
If you're exploring an instant personal loan app, your current employment is only one part of the picture. Lenders may also consider factors such as your income, credit history, previous work experience and their own eligibility criteria.
For instance, someone who has recently switched jobs after several years of work experience may be assessed differently from someone applying for credit soon after starting their first job.
That is why there is no single answer for every newly employed borrower. Eligibility can depend on your overall financial and employment profile.
An offer letter is great news, but it may not tell a lender everything they need to know about your finances. If you're considering an instant cash personal loan app, there are a few details that may be checked before your application is assessed.
These can include:
Your monthly income
How long you have been with your current employer
Previous employment history
Salary credits in your bank account
Credit score and repayment history
Employer details
Probation can make things a little uncertain when you’re applying for a pre-approved personal loan. You’ve got the job, but you’re still new enough that some lenders may want to know more about your employment.
Your previous job, income, credit history and repayment record can all matter here. Someone who has worked for a few years and recently changed jobs may have a different borrowing profile from someone starting their first job.
So, if you’re checking an instant personal loan app, don’t assume probation means an automatic rejection. Check the lender’s requirements, share the right details, and see whether you meet the eligibility criteria.
When an unexpected expense appears, it is easy to search for an instant personal loan app and apply to several platforms within a few hours. But a quick application should not mean a rushed borrowing decision. Before applying, take a moment to ask yourself:
How much do I actually need?
Borrowing ?2 lakh for an expense that requires ?60,000 may create unnecessary repayment pressure.
Can I manage the monthly EMI with my new salary?
A new job can sometimes come with relocation costs, new commuting expenses or other changes to your monthly budget.
Have I checked the total cost of the loan?
Interest, processing fees, applicable charges and repayment terms all deserve your attention.

Once you find an option, read the details carefully. Look beyond the approved amount and focus on what the repayment will realistically mean for your monthly finances.
Yes, you may be able to. But getting a new job doesn't guarantee loan approval, just as being new at your company doesn't mean you will be rejected.
Lenders may look at your income, credit history, work experience, documents and their own eligibility rules before making a decision.
If you do need a loan, don't rush into the first option you see. Check what you qualify for, borrow only what you need and, most importantly, make sure the EMI works with your new salary.
You might be able to. It mainly depends on the lender and your overall profile. Your income, previous work experience, credit history and time spent in the new job can all matter.
Being on probation doesn't automatically rule you out. Some lenders may accept applications from probationary employees, while others may have different requirements. It's worth checking before you apply.
You can explore your options through an instant personal loan app, but being able to apply doesn't mean you'll automatically qualify. The lender will still check its eligibility requirements and your financial details.
Start with the EMI. Can you comfortably manage it from your new salary? Then check the interest rate, processing fee, other charges, and repayment period. If you're considering a loan for newly joined employees, borrow only what you actually need.
